12p1331 is a chromosomal region located on the short arm of human chromosome 12. Specifically, it refers to the 12th chromosome's p arm, band 13, sub-band 3, region 1. This designation follows the standard International System for Chromosome Nomenclature (ISCN) for describing chromosome structure.
